How to use a Type C power charger for recharging your Jabra Solemate from a Tajikistani power outlet

Using type B USB micro connector with a three pinned Type C USB adapter to power the Jabra Solemate with a Tajikistani power outlet.

  1. If you want to charge the Jabra Solemate using the Tajikistani power outlet you will need to buy a Type C USB power plug adapter [4] and a USB 2.0 A Male to Micro B cable [5].
  2. Start by inserting the Type C USB power plug adapter into the wall supply. The wall supply (called the Type C power outlet [3] or Europlug) is identified by the two holes adjacent to each other.
  3. Plug in the USB end of the USB 2.0 A Male to Micro B cable into the USB mains adapter and the other end into the USB charging port on the Jabra Solemate. The USB charging port can be located on the right of the speaker below the line in port.
  4. Switch on the Tajikistani power outlet.
  5. The battery indicator on the Jabra Solemate will glow red when low, yellow when half full and green when fully charged. Typically the battery will take 2.5 hours to completely charge although this may take longer if you use the Jabra Solemate whilst charging. [AD]
